The postcode DA15 8WP is located in Bexley, in the county of Outer London. It was introduced in August 1992 and is an active postcode. DA15 8WP is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

DA15 8WP is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DA15 8WP as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> Multi-ethnic professionals with families.

The closest road name to DA15 8WP is Redwood Close which is centered 43 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Oaklands Avenue and is 207 m away. The closest railway station is Sidcup Rail Station, 855 m away.

The closest primary school to DA15 8WP (for ages 11 and under) is Burnt Oak Junior School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Outstanding on July 11,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Chislehurst and Sidcup Grammar School. The last OFSTED inspection on September 19, 2017 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of DA15 8WP is The Hangar Sidcup and is 400 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on September 28,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from New World Chinese Take Away and is 400 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on October 2, 2018.

Residents reported an average download speed of 24.6 Mbps and an average upload speed of 7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.3 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.5 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for DA15 8WP is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Bexley is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
